Nikki Haley resigns as US ambassador to UN
October 09, 2018  20:29
image
US Ambassador to the United Nations Nikki Haley resigned Tuesday directly to President Donald Trump, according to multiple sources familiar with her decision.

A senior State Department official said Haley told her staff this morning.

A source familiar with the matter said Haley's resignation caught national security adviser John Bolton and Secretary of State Mike Pompeo by surprise.

Teasing an announcement in the Oval Office this morning, Trump called Haley "my friend."

"Big announcement with my friend Ambassador Nikki Haley in the Oval Office at 10:30am," he tweeted.

During her more than a year-and-a-half on the job, she has repeatedly spoken her mind, whether it's going further on human rights than many of her administration colleagues or denouncing racism at home.
